Transaction 61b84b39e0c13c23f9f2a3418a424f1709b7054de5344ef678292e27ef1623a5

block
1160ed0e06b1b9fff351bd3053830f0dbd3479f39619132d1d99cfc8251979f9

2 Inputs

2 Outputs